Searched refs:BooleanContent (Results 1 – 11 of 11) sorted by relevance
117 enum BooleanContent { enum145 static ISD::NodeType getExtendForContent(BooleanContent Content) { in getExtendForContent()406 BooleanContent getBooleanContents(bool isVec, bool isFloat) const { in getBooleanContents()412 BooleanContent getBooleanContents(EVT Type) const { in getBooleanContents()1304 void setBooleanContents(BooleanContent Ty) { in setBooleanContents()1311 void setBooleanContents(BooleanContent IntTy, BooleanContent FloatTy) { in setBooleanContents()1318 void setBooleanVectorContents(BooleanContent Ty) { in setBooleanVectorContents()1941 BooleanContent BooleanContents;1945 BooleanContent BooleanFloatContents;1949 BooleanContent BooleanVectorContents;
110 enum BooleanContent { // How the target represents true/false values. enum116 static ISD::NodeType getExtendForContent(BooleanContent Content) { in getExtendForContent()184 BooleanContent getBooleanContents(bool isVec) const { in getBooleanContents()964 void setBooleanContents(BooleanContent Ty) { BooleanContents = Ty; } in setBooleanContents()968 void setBooleanVectorContents(BooleanContent Ty) { in setBooleanVectorContents()1692 BooleanContent BooleanContents;1696 BooleanContent BooleanVectorContents;
140 enum BooleanContent { enum204 static ISD::NodeType getExtendForContent(BooleanContent Content) { in getExtendForContent()583 BooleanContent getBooleanContents(bool isVec, bool isFloat) const { in getBooleanContents()589 BooleanContent getBooleanContents(EVT Type) const { in getBooleanContents()1697 void setBooleanContents(BooleanContent Ty) { in setBooleanContents()1704 void setBooleanContents(BooleanContent IntTy, BooleanContent FloatTy) { in setBooleanContents()1711 void setBooleanVectorContents(BooleanContent Ty) { in setBooleanVectorContents()2391 BooleanContent BooleanContents;2395 BooleanContent BooleanFloatContents;2399 BooleanContent BooleanVectorContents;
1266 TargetLowering::BooleanContent Cnt = getBooleanContents(VT); in isExtendedTrueVal()1355 TargetLowering::BooleanContent Cnt = in SimplifySetCC()
289 TargetLowering::BooleanContent ScalarBool = in ScalarizeVecRes_VSELECT()291 TargetLowering::BooleanContent VecBool = TLI.getBooleanContents(true, false); in ScalarizeVecRes_VSELECT()
1024 TargetLowering::BooleanContent BType = TLI->getBooleanContents(OpVT); in getBoolExtOrTrunc()1900 TargetLowering::BooleanContent Cnt = in FoldSetCC()
1766 TargetLoweringBase::BooleanContent BoolType = TLI.getBooleanContents(NVT); in ExpandIntRes_ADDSUB()
325 TargetLowering::BooleanContent ScalarBool = in ScalarizeVecRes_VSELECT()327 TargetLowering::BooleanContent VecBool = TLI.getBooleanContents(true, false); in ScalarizeVecRes_VSELECT()
1329 TargetLoweringBase::BooleanContent BoolType = TLI.getBooleanContents(VT); in PromoteIntOp_ADDSUBCARRY()1856 TargetLoweringBase::BooleanContent BoolType = TLI.getBooleanContents(NVT); in ExpandIntRes_ADDSUB()
765 BooleanContent::ZeroOrNegativeOneBooleanContent) { in SimplifyDemandedBits()1780 TargetLowering::BooleanContent Cnt = getBooleanContents(VT); in isExtendedTrueVal()
1105 TargetLowering::BooleanContent BType = TLI->getBooleanContents(OpVT); in getBoolExtOrTrunc()